As swine flu hits the headlines, feature film Pig Business exposes the shocking truth about cheap pork products in British supermarkets – lifting the lid on the distressing practices of factory pig farming and the devastating impact it is having on people, the environment and livestock.
 
Filmmaker and campaigner Tracy Worcester spent over four years researching the factory pig farming business in Europe which supplies over 60% of our UK markets, uncovering the suffering of people living near the huge meat factories whose air and water have been polluted, and showing horrifying footage of dead and dying pigs from undercover filming.
 
The resulting film Pig Business is a powerful exposé on the factory pork industry.
